Default Just got back from CA Speedway

What a great time! My first time on a track with my Z, and it was awesome. Hugh shout out to Michael at VRT for inviting me, and for the great job they did getting my Vortech installed and running.

I think I did real well for my first time. I passed a lot of people and was never passed. By the end of the third session, I was hitting apexes more consistantly and was fairly happy the progress I made.

I was really able to push the car and happily found that its limits were a lot more than I had previously thought. Right now the car can handle more than I am comfortable giving it. More track time and I should be more comfortable with the high speed turning, but right now my brain is saying whoa!

For anyone that hasn't done this, I highly recommend it. Its so much more satisfying than autocross because you can attack the turns over and over again until you get it right.
